Command conventions
The following information describes how each command is organized:
Name: 
Name of command.
ASCII: 
The ASCII control code.
Hexadecimal: 
The hexadecimal control code.
Decimal: 
The decimal control code.
Value: 
A description of the command operands.
Range: 
The upper and lower limits of the command operand.
Default: 
The command operand default after printer reset.
Description:  
Brief description and summary of the command.
Formulas: 
Any formulas used for this command.
Exceptions: 
Describes any exceptions to this command; for example, incompatible commands.
Related information:  Describes related information for this command; for example, bit information.

Clear printer
ASCII 
DLE 
Hexadecimal  10 
Decimal 
16
Clears the print line buffer without printing and sets the printer to the following condition:
•  Double-wide command (0x12) is canceled
•  Line spacing, pitch, and user-defined character sets are maintained at current selections (RAM is not affected)
•  Single-wide, single-high, non-rotated, and left-aligned characters are set
•  Printing position is set to column one
Related Information
This command is recognized in A793 emulation and A799 native mode, ignored in LEGACY emulation.
